Master the Art of USB Transfers: Move Your Tracks with Ease
- Initiate the process by establishing a connection. Use the USB cable that accompanies your Android device for a reliable link.
- Upon connecting, Windows may introduce an autoplay dialog box to manage the device within its file system. Opt for a setting that acknowledges your phone as a media device; this is commonly known as MTP mode.
- In instances where autoplay does not intervene, manually launch Windows Media Player on your PC.
- Spot the sync list on your PC by clicking the Sync tab or by identifying the Sync button within the Windows Media Player toolbar. Your Android device should appear as a transfer recipient.
- Prepare your music for transfer by dragging albums or individual songs into the sync list. Should you wish to move an entire album, it will queue all its tracks for transfer.
- Kickstart the transfer by hitting the Start Sync button. This action prompts the movement of your chosen music from PC to Android.
- Once synchronization concludes, you may disconnect the Android device from the USB cable and enjoy your music on the move.

FAQs: Music Transfer Mastery
Q: What do I need to transfer music from my PC to an Android phone?
A: You’ll need your Android device, a USB cable, and ideally, Windows Media Player installed on your PC to facilitate the transfer.
Q: Can I transfer my entire music library at once to my Android device?
A: Yes, you can select to transfer entire albums or multiple songs simultaneously by dragging them into the sync list in Windows Media Player before initiating the transfer.
